30003355073 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 30003355074. Its totient is φ = 30003355072.

The previous prime is 30003355007. The next prime is 30003355087. The reversal of 30003355073 is 37055330003.

It is a strong prime.

It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 19895666704 + 10107688369 = 141052^2 + 100537^2 .

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 30003355073 - 222 = 29999160769 is a prime.

It is a Sophie Germain prime.

It is a Curzon number.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(30003355003)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 15001677536 + 15001677537.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(15001677537).

Almost surely, 230003355073 is an apocalyptic number.

It is an amenable number.

30003355073 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

30003355073 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

30003355073 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 14175, while the sum is 29.

Adding to 30003355073 its reverse (37055330003), we get a palindrome (67058685076).

The spelling of 30003355073 in words is "thirty billion, three million, three hundred fifty-five thousand, seventy-three".
